I was looking at xend_internal.c and wondered why sexpr_int's
sexpr pointer wasn't const... surely, it *can't* modify that, I thought.
So I made it const, and pulled the thread, which ended up making most
of the sexpr* parameters in sexpr.[ch] const.

I added the few inevitable casts, but imho, that cost is far
outweighed by having accurate prototypes for all of these functions.
